Strategic Foresight is a structured and systematic framework/discipline of using ideas about the future to anticipate and better prepare for change. It is about exploring different plausible futures that could arise, and the opportunities and challenges they could present.

In this talk, we will workshop through the different processes and methods of applying strategic foresight for your industry and organization, including horizon scanning, Scenario Planning, and Windtunnelling your strategies. You will learn how to be prepared not just for one future, but multiple potential future scenarios in order to future-proof your business.
